From fa5bbf6954cb83a088cebe48bd6c66b02757a3d2 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Nourrisse Florian Date: Thu, 8 Jan 2026 01:38:52 +0100 Subject: [PATCH] feat: add MHS35 script for Kali Linux on Raspberry Pi 5 The original MHS35-show script fails on Kali Linux / Pi 5 due to: - raspi-config not available on Kali - Different boot paths (/boot/firmware/ vs /boot/) - No /etc/rc.local (Kali uses systemd) - Missing Raspberry Pi OS specific config files This new script auto-detects the boot directory and works without raspi-config dependency.
